Responsibilities:
Check each resident routinely to ensure that his/her personal care needs are being met in accordance with his/her wishes Review patient care plans daily to determine if changes in the resident's daily care routine have been made on the care plan Inform the nurse supervisor of any changes in the resident's condition so that appropriate information can be entered on the resident's care plan Assist resident's with daily needs, including preparation for activity and social programs, and transporting residents to/from appointments Ensure residents' rooms are ready for receiving and help residents feel comfortable Participate in facility surveys by authorized government agencies Maintain confidentiality of all resident care information in accordance with HIPAA guidelines Effectively communicate necessary resident information to charge nurses, director of nursing, and/or administrator
